Kwapinski
, J. B. (University of New England, Armidale, N.S.W., Australia). Antigenic structure of
Actinomycetales
. VI. Serological relationships between antigenic fractions of
Actinomyces
and
Nocardia
. J. Bacteriol.
86:
179–186. 1963.—A total of 52 chemical fractions were obtained by a comprehensive technique of preparation from three strains of
Actinomyces
and three strains of
Nocardia
. The chemical and serological structures and specificities of disintegrated cells, cell walls, cytoplasms, and individual fractions were thoroughly studied. Cytoplasmic materials were found to be serologically alike or identical. The polysaccharide fractions, extracted from cell walls with alkali, formamide, and phenol, proved to be serologically related. Fractions prepared from the
Nocardia
by extractions in hot and concentrated solutions of acetic acid and sodium hydroxide, as well as the second protein fraction and the acetate-extracted polysaccharides of both the
Nocardia
and
Actinomyces
, proved to be genus-specific.
